We recommend this optional refresher course for our students who want to review all 18 sessions. The key focus of this class is to go over key points that students can expect to find on the state real estate exam.  The class is taught by one of the AARE instructors and will key in on important aspects of each of the 18 sessions.  We recommend attending all 18 sessions before attending this class.

Didn't take your real estate course with AARE?

No problem!  You are welcome to attend this course regardless of whether you attending AARE for your licensing program.  It is often times helpful to get a fresh perspective of the topics covered on the Arizona Real Estate Exam and we are continually updating our cirricuium to keep our students up to date on what to expect at the state exam. You will also receive a study packet that you can use to further study for the exam.

 A Checklist for Obtaining an Arizona Real Estate License

 

1 Complete AARE's 90-hour Sales Prelicense Course

 

 

2 Pass AARE's School Examination

 

  • Students must complete all sessions prior to taking the school examination
  • Students register for the school exam on the AARE website
  • Students must receive a score of 80% on one school exam to receive the Prelicensure Education Certificate

 

3 Pass the Arizona State Exam (Pearson) with a score of at least 75%

 

 

4 Complete the 6-hour Intro Contract Writing class

 

  • This class can be taken at any time. You will need to complete this class before you can activate your real estate license.

 

5 Obtain a Security Clearance Card from the Department of Public Safety

 

  • The application is provided in the back of the Student Manual
  • This process takes approximately 4-8 weeks

 

6 Apply for a real estate sales license at Arizona Department of Real Estate, 2910 N 44th Street #140, Phoenix, AZ 85018. ADRE will accept applications for processing Monday through Friday 8:00am - 4:30pm

  • Prelicensure Education Certificate
  • State Test Passing Certificate(s)
  • Original Licensure Questionnaire – Form LI-214/244
  • DPS Security Clearance Card
  • Intro Contract Writing Certificate
  • Broker Hiring Form – LI-202
  • License fee of $125
  • Real Estate Recovery Fund contribution of $10

Requirement Changes In Effect for New Agents

Licensees are now required to obtain a Security Clearance Card prior to getting a license.  An application form must be completed and submitted to the Department of Public Safety along with a fingerprint card and a money order for $69.  The waiting period can be between 4 weeks to 6 weeks.
